The Phoenix Contact printed circuit board terminal block, part of the SMKDS 3 series, stands out with its robust design and efficient connection capabilities. Featuring a pitch of 5.08 mm, it allows for precise and reliable connections within various applications. The terminal block supports a nominal current of 24 A and a rated voltage of 400 V, making it suitable for a range of electrical tasks. Its straightforward screw connection method facilitates easy installation, and the integrated protective guide ensures optimal conductor placement without the risk of incorrect insertion. With a durable green housing made from PA insulating material, this component not only meets high-performance standards but is also compliant with WEEE and RoHS directives, ensuring minimal environmental impact. Ideal for complex configurations, this terminal block allows flexible arrangements on the PCB without compromising safety or efficiency.
